Overview
Serving 746 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Birmingham Falls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 82%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 80%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Georgia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is lower than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black).
Serving 795 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Cogburn Woods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 74%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 71% (which is higher than the Georgia state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Georgia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 59% of the student body (majority Asian and Black), which is lower than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black and Hispanic).
